Soak catfish in milk for at least an hour.
Preheat oven to 250 degrees.
Heat oil in a deep fryer, enough to cover the fish or whatever your deep fryer suggest, to 350 degrees.
Place hot sauce in shallow dish.
In another shallow dish, combine cornmeal, flour, salt, black pepper, old bay seasoning, and paprika.
Remove catfish from milk and coat in hot sauce. Then coat fish in breading mixture and fry to golden brown, about 4 minutes. Fry 2 fillets at a time.
Place fillets in oven to keep warm. Repeat with remaining pieces.
